4、使用Qt创建丰富的数据可视化界面

使用Qt创建丰富的数据可视化界面

1. 引言

在现代应用程序开发中,数据可视化扮演着至关重要的角色。无论是用于企业数据分析还是用户界面设计,图表和图形都能有效地传达复杂信息。Qt框架提供了强大的图表模块,使得开发者可以轻松创建各种类型的图表,从而提升用户体验。本文将详细介绍如何使用Qt创建丰富的数据可视化界面,涵盖从基本概念到实际应用的各个方面。

2. Qt图表和图形类型

Qt支持多种常用的图表类型,每种类型都有其独特的应用场景。以下是几种常见的图表类型:

  • 折线图和样条曲线图 :适用于展示连续数据的变化趋势。折线图通过直线连接数据点,而样条曲线图则使用平滑曲线连接数据点。
  • 条形图 :适合比较不同类别的数据。条形图通过矩形的高度表示数值大小。
  • 饼图 :用于展示各部分占整体的比例。饼图以扇形切片的形式呈现数据。
  • 极坐标图 :以圆形图表展示数据,数据点的位置由角度和距离决定,适合展示周期性数据。
  • 面积图和散点图 :面积图用于展示数据的累积效果,散点图则用于展示两个变量之间的关系。
  • 箱形图和K线图 :箱形图用于展示数据分布,K线图则常用于金融领域的价格波动分析。

这些图表类型可以根据实际需求灵活选择,Qt图表模块提供了丰富的API,使得创建和自定义这些图表变得非常简单。 </

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值